Acclaimed architects unveil plans for the Obama Presidential Center library in Hawaii

1/7

Obama Presidential Centre proposal by Snøhetta and WCIT Architecture

Three teams of internationally acclaimed architects just unveiled proposals to build Barack Obama's presidential library in Hawaii. The University of Hawaii commissioned firms including Snøhetta, WCIT Architecture, Allied Works, MOS, and Workshop-Hi to propose designs for the building as part of the state's bid to construct the new Obama Presidential Center near the Kaka'ako Waterfront Park in Honalulu.
